Her gaze was on a young man at the foot of the hill. He had the darkest hair she had ever seen, a colour she could only describe as obsidian, and eyes as dark as the abyss. He was a tall and thin young man who wore silk robes and extravagant gold embroidered sleeves. He was from a wealthy family and he dressed to reflect that. He had a single red rose in his hand as he stood at the edge of the lake. The sun was far from setting, it was mid-afternoon and the grass couldn't have been greener or the sky bluer. The sound of a galloping horse broke her gaze from the man and she saw her smile fade into a grimace. On the horse was an angelic beauty with voluptuous waves of platinum blonde hair and piercing blue eyes, it was her sister, Cecilia. She turned her gaze back to the man, who was transfixed on the angel on the horse galloping towards him. She couldn't bare the sight. Both of her own heartbreaking and the sight of her sister with the man of her dreams. It was cruel to make her watch the moment in third person. She still remembered what she felt as she stood there in the moment and now she was forced to watch herself ache.

The vision blurred. The day had turned to dark and she now watched herself in the stables, sitting atop a pile of hay and a bucket of water fresh from the well beside her feet. She had her diary resting on her lap, a navy, leather-bound book with a rose engraving on its spine. The ends of her favourite dress were muddied and ruined but she couldn't care less. She listened to the sound of her sister humming nearby as she ran her fingers through her tangled brown hair. She wondered why her sister was blessed with silk-like hair, while her own appeared to be of dirt and mulch. It wasn't fair. It's not fair.

She brushed her thumb along the spine of her diary. So many years of living in her sister's shadow, so many years of never once getting what she wanted had been poured into the book. Her parent's constant disapproval of her, from the way she dressed to how the tip of her nose just wasn't quite sharp enough. How the boy she'd grown up loving had simply forgotten she had existed the moment he met her sister. He was almost her first kiss. Years ago, their lips barely brushed before Cecilia came waltzing down the hill towards the lake, she watched him freeze as his gaze was captured by a glowing goddess floating down the hill. It had been sunset and the reflection had made Cecilia's hair look of warm honey. It was the perfect time of day... the perfect time of day for a first kiss and for her sister to steal her love away.

She closed her eyes, quickly dozing off as the night turned silent. Her sister had stopped humming. Perhaps, she'd gone to sleep as well.

"Vivienne?"

A warm whisper slithered through her ear. She remembered what she was thinking in that moment; Does she respond? Does she pretend to have fallen deep asleep?

"Vivienne, I know you're awake." There was no menace in the way he spoke, but his very presence threatened her peace.

Why was he here? What did he want? Were only a few of the questions swimming through her mind.

She felt the weight shift against the hay as he sat beside her. His warmth blanketed her, she'd almost fallen back asleep, but an abrupt attack to the knot between her brows brought her jolting up and wide awake, "Holy bells! Tom, what on earth?!" she yelped.

He'd painfully flicked her forehead and it had stung like 10 ants. She was now wide awake, staring deep into the abyssal eyes of the young man who wouldn't leave her mind. She noted that they hadn't spoken in years, they hadn't even set foot in the same room. Yet, here he was. Tom Riddle, dressed casually in an airy white top, his bare chest exposed to her hungry eyes, his body almost touching hers as he sat beside her. Is this a dream? She remembered thinking. If I kiss him now, will I wake up? "Tom, what are you doing here." She bravely questioned.

His lips turned into a playful boyish grin, he almost looked smug as he left her gaze and laid himself flat on the hay. "I'm here to enjoy your company, Vivienne."
